Taylor Barnard Declares First Formula E Victory Is “Not Far Away” After Career-Best Jeddah Weekend

Taylor Barnard is making it loud and clear—his first Formula E win is coming soon. After a sensational weekend in Jeddah, the NEOM McLaren rookie surged into second place in the championship, proving he’s already a serious contender in his first full-time season.

With a third-place finish on Friday, pole position on Saturday, and a runner-up finish in the second race, Barnard walked away from Saudi Arabia with three podiums from four races—a dream start for a driver who was only a stand-in last season.

“It’s not far away,” Barnard said confidently. “I think I’m just collecting all of the colors at the moment, but that’s definitely my target. When the car can do it, I’ll definitely do my best. The focus for myself at the moment is just to keep scoring these big points. It’s important for myself and for the team, and it will come.”

Rising Fast: Barnard’s Championship Surge

Few expected the 20-year-old to be sitting second in the Formula E standings this early in the season. But with three podiums in four races, Barnard has put himself on the same level as current championship leader Oliver Rowland, who has also secured two wins and a second place.

Even Barnard himself was surprised by his incredible form.

“Coming into this weekend, I didn’t expect to take home three trophies and a lot of points,” he admitted. “I couldn’t have asked for much better. The team have done a great job, given me a great car, and I’ve managed to execute.”

Why Barnard Couldn’t Convert Pole to a Win in Jeddah

While Maximilian Guenther converted pole position into a victory on Friday, Barnard found himself facing a tougher challenge on Saturday. The second race required more energy-saving, and the absence of Pit Boost made it impossible to maintain the lead from start to finish.

“Today was such a different race compared to yesterday,” Barnard explained. “We have to recover and regenerate 10 percent more energy than yesterday, so I knew keeping the lead for the whole race was going to be almost impossible.”

Despite needing to drop back and conserve energy, Barnard still managed to fight back and secure second place—a result that left him more than satisfied.

“I could do it, just … just hold on to second. Starting from pole and finishing second, I’m super happy.”

What’s Next? Barnard Eyes the Top Step of the Podium

With his first win now within reach, Barnard has established himself as one of the breakout stars of Formula E. His rapid rise and ability to execute under pressure have put NEOM McLaren in a strong position early in the season.

With momentum building and his confidence at an all-time high, Barnard’s first victory seems inevitable.

The only question now is: when will the young star finally stand on the top step of the podium?
